Intern eCommerce– Health Systems Marketing – Cambridge, MA – Summer 2026

Philips is a health technology company dedicated to improving healthcare access for everyone. They are seeking an intern for their eCommerce Health Systems Marketing team to support digital campaign programs and enhance the eStore experience for customers.

B2BConsumer ElectronicsElectronicsLightingWellness
badNo H1Bnote

Responsibilities

Work with Digital campaign programs team to develop and integrate digital programs (organic and paid) across the customer journey to support achievement of online sales activities and objectives
Partner with creative teams and content teams to build-out and optimize design and content to have a best-in-class eStore experience for our customers
Support Sales and Business Managers in their execution of their sales strategies and plans
Be part of a team to establish and drive a regular cadence of reviewing key performance metrics versus target and identification of root causes and actions needed to drive continuous improvement
Collaborate with Central Global Digital organization and other global market teams to scale best practices for Philips eCommerce
Identify new business development opportunities proof of concept testing within direct online space to consistently grow business for maximum value realization
